Stephen Curry has been one of the best basketball players in the world ever since he broke out for the Golden State Warriors in a huge way during the 2012-13 season. That was 13 years ago. But still, even though Curry is in the 17th year of his professional career, he remains a legitimate superstar and has shown little-to-no signs of aging, as he entered the Dubs' Monday night clash coming off a 35-point contest against the Portland Trail Blazers and a 42-point heater against the Denver Nuggets the game before that.
